 14#[derive(Clone, Copy, Debug, PartialEq, Eq, Deserialize, Serialize)]
 15pub enum Mode {
 16    Normal,
 17    Insert,
 18    Replace,
 19    Visual,
 20    VisualLine,
 21    VisualBlock,
 22}
 23
 24impl Display for Mode {
 25    fn fmt(&self, f: &mut std::fmt::Formatter<'_>) -> std::fmt::Result {
 26        match self {
 27            Mode::Normal => write!(f, "NORMAL"),
 28            Mode::Insert => write!(f, "INSERT"),
 29            Mode::Replace => write!(f, "REPLACE"),
 30            Mode::Visual => write!(f, "VISUAL"),
 31            Mode::VisualLine => write!(f, "VISUAL LINE"),
 32            Mode::VisualBlock => write!(f, "VISUAL BLOCK"),
 33        }
 34    }
 35}
 36
 37impl Mode {
 38    pub fn is_visual(&self) -> bool {
 39        match self {
 40            Mode::Normal | Mode::Insert | Mode::Replace => false,
 41            Mode::Visual | Mode::VisualLine | Mode::VisualBlock => true,
 42        }
 43    }
 44}
 45
 46impl Default for Mode {
 47    fn default() -> Self {
 48        Self::Normal
 49    }
 50}
 51
 52#[derive(Clone, Debug, PartialEq, Eq, Deserialize)]
 53pub enum Operator {
 54    Change,
 55    Delete,
 56    Yank,
 57    Replace,
 58    Object { around: bool },
 59    FindForward { before: bool },
 60    FindBackward { after: bool },
 61    AddSurrounds { target: Option<SurroundsType> },
 62    ChangeSurrounds { target: Option<Object> },
 63    DeleteSurrounds,
 64    Mark,
 65    Jump { line: bool },
 66    Indent,
 67    Outdent,
 68    Lowercase,
 69    Uppercase,
 70    OppositeCase,
 71    Register,
 72    RecordRegister,
 73    ReplayRegister,
 74}
 75
 76#[derive(Default, Clone)]
 77pub struct EditorState {
 78    pub mode: Mode,
 79    pub last_mode: Mode,
 80
 81    /// pre_count is the number before an operator is specified (3 in 3d2d)
 82    pub pre_count: Option<usize>,
 83    /// post_count is the number after an operator is specified (2 in 3d2d)
 84    pub post_count: Option<usize>,
 85
 86    pub operator_stack: Vec<Operator>,
 87    pub replacements: Vec<(Range<editor::Anchor>, String)>,
 88
 89    pub marks: HashMap<String, Vec<Anchor>>,
 90    pub stored_visual_mode: Option<(Mode, Vec<bool>)>,
 91    pub change_list: Vec<Vec<Anchor>>,
 92    pub change_list_position: Option<usize>,
 93
 94    pub current_tx: Option<TransactionId>,
 95    pub current_anchor: Option<Selection<Anchor>>,
 96    pub undo_modes: HashMap<TransactionId, Mode>,
 97
 98    pub selected_register: Option<char>,
 99    pub search: SearchState,
100}

215impl EditorState {
216    pub fn cursor_shape(&self) -> CursorShape {
217        match self.mode {
218            Mode::Normal => {
219                if self.operator_stack.is_empty() {
220                    CursorShape::Block
221                } else {
222                    CursorShape::Underscore
223                }
224            }
225            Mode::Replace => CursorShape::Underscore,
226            Mode::Visual | Mode::VisualLine | Mode::VisualBlock => CursorShape::Block,
227            Mode::Insert => CursorShape::Bar,
228        }
229    }
230
231    pub fn vim_controlled(&self) -> bool {
232        let is_insert_mode = matches!(self.mode, Mode::Insert);
233        if !is_insert_mode {
234            return true;
235        }
236        matches!(
237            self.operator_stack.last(),
238            Some(Operator::FindForward { .. })
239                | Some(Operator::FindBackward { .. })
240                | Some(Operator::Mark)
241                | Some(Operator::Register)
242                | Some(Operator::RecordRegister)
243                | Some(Operator::ReplayRegister)
244                | Some(Operator::Jump { .. })
245        )
246    }
247
248    pub fn should_autoindent(&self) -> bool {
249        !(self.mode == Mode::Insert && self.last_mode == Mode::VisualBlock)
250    }
251
252    pub fn clip_at_line_ends(&self) -> bool {
253        match self.mode {
254            Mode::Insert | Mode::Visual | Mode::VisualLine | Mode::VisualBlock | Mode::Replace => {
255                false
256            }
257            Mode::Normal => true,
258        }
259    }
260
261    pub fn active_operator(&self) -> Option<Operator> {
262        self.operator_stack.last().cloned()
263    }
264
265    pub fn keymap_context_layer(&self) -> KeyContext {
266        let mut context = KeyContext::new_with_defaults();
267        context.set(
268            "vim_mode",
269            match self.mode {
270                Mode::Normal => "normal",
271                Mode::Visual | Mode::VisualLine | Mode::VisualBlock => "visual",
272                Mode::Insert => "insert",
273                Mode::Replace => "replace",
274            },
275        );
276
277        if self.vim_controlled() {
278            context.add("VimControl");
279        }
280
281        if self.active_operator().is_none() && self.pre_count.is_some()
282            || self.active_operator().is_some() && self.post_count.is_some()
283        {
284            context.add("VimCount");
285        }
286
287        let active_operator = self.active_operator();
288
289        if let Some(active_operator) = active_operator.clone() {
290            for context_flag in active_operator.context_flags().into_iter() {
291                context.add(*context_flag);
292            }
293        }
294
295        context.set(
296            "vim_operator",
297            active_operator
298                .clone()
299                .map(|op| op.id())
300                .unwrap_or_else(|| "none"),
301        );
302
303        if self.mode == Mode::Replace
304            || (matches!(active_operator, Some(Operator::AddSurrounds { .. }))
305                && self.mode.is_visual())
306        {
307            context.add("VimWaiting");
308        }
309        context
310    }
311}
312
313impl Operator {
314    pub fn id(&self) -> &'static str {
315        match self {
316            Operator::Object { around: false } => "i",
317            Operator::Object { around: true } => "a",
318            Operator::Change => "c",
319            Operator::Delete => "d",
320            Operator::Yank => "y",
321            Operator::Replace => "r",
322            Operator::FindForward { before: false } => "f",
323            Operator::FindForward { before: true } => "t",
324            Operator::FindBackward { after: false } => "F",
325            Operator::FindBackward { after: true } => "T",
326            Operator::AddSurrounds { .. } => "ys",
327            Operator::ChangeSurrounds { .. } => "cs",
328            Operator::DeleteSurrounds => "ds",
329            Operator::Mark => "m",
330            Operator::Jump { line: true } => "'",
331            Operator::Jump { line: false } => "`",
332            Operator::Indent => ">",
333            Operator::Outdent => "<",
334            Operator::Uppercase => "gU",
335            Operator::Lowercase => "gu",
336            Operator::OppositeCase => "g~",
337            Operator::Register => "\"",
338            Operator::RecordRegister => "q",
339            Operator::ReplayRegister => "@",
340        }
341    }
342
343    pub fn context_flags(&self) -> &'static [&'static str] {
344        match self {
345            Operator::Object { .. } | Operator::ChangeSurrounds { target: None } => &["VimObject"],
346            Operator::FindForward { .. }
347            | Operator::Mark
348            | Operator::Jump { .. }
349            | Operator::FindBackward { .. }
350            | Operator::Register
351            | Operator::RecordRegister
352            | Operator::ReplayRegister
353            | Operator::Replace
354            | Operator::AddSurrounds { target: Some(_) }
355            | Operator::ChangeSurrounds { .. }
356            | Operator::DeleteSurrounds => &["VimWaiting"],
357            _ => &[],
358        }
359    }
360}
